I bought 2 Maxtor STM3160211AS 160GB SATAII 7200RPM 2MB Cache, and I wanted to run them as Raid 0. However after inspecting the HDD's closer I found that the jumper settings shows that the HDD will run at 1.5G.

What I need to know is it possible to remove the default jumper (its a half jumper) and run them as 3G Stripping.

Should work fine as far as I know. A few manufacturers ship the drives out jumpered for 1.5Gb/s as 3Gb/s currently offers very little performance increase (if any) for single drives and it avoids the odd problems with certain early SATA controllers which don't auto-negotiate the speed. Remove the jumpers and the drives should just run a 3Gb/s without any problems.
